Abstract | The Multigap Resistive Plate Chambers (MRPC) have been using in many experiments for the purpose of particle identification by the measurement of time-of-flight, thanks to its excellent timing performance. We present here a new design of a large size MRPC. It consists of double stack with three gaps of 250 μm each with long readout strips. The sensitive area is 85×85cm$^2$. The aim of this design was to reduce the applied voltage. Gas distribution tubes have been added to improve the uniformity of the gas flow to the entire sensitive area of large MRPC. |
